Record Number of Women Celebrated With English Heritage Blue Plaques in 2024

Britain's first female press photographer and first female neurosurgeon among those to receive plaques.

For the first time in the history of the London Blue Plaques Scheme, which has been running for more than 150 years, more plaques will be unveiled to individual women in 2024 than in any previous year.

We launched the 'plaques for women' campaign in 2016, encouraging the public to nominate more remarkable female figures from the past. This initiative is now bearing fruit on the streets of London. 

 

New Blue Plaques For 2024

The pioneering women who will be celebrated with blue plaques in 2024 include

  • Christina Broom, believed to have been Britain's first female press photographer
  • Diana Beck, celebrated as the UK's first female neurosurgeon
  • Jazz singer, Adelaide Hall, one of the first Black women to secure a long-term contract at the BBC
  • and Irene Barclay, the first woman to qualify as a chartered surveyor.

There will be further blue plaque recipients throughout the year.
